‘Another level of confusion’: private contractors at odds over whether they were meant to vaccinate aged care staff

by
Christopher Knaus
from World news | The Guardian on (#5JP0X)

Four contractors have differing answers on whether the government contractually obliged them to vaccinate staff

The four private companies responsible for vaccinating the aged care sector have given conflicting accounts about whether the government ever contracted them to inoculate staff, prompting further criticism about the confusing and delayed rollout.

The federal government, in the early stages of the rollout, said it would rely on private contractors to vaccinate 183,000 aged care residents and 339,000 staff, using in-reach teams that would attend each facility.
